WebThere is decreased mental efficiency due the prolonged deficiency of oxygen Sleepiness, headache, lassitude and fatigubility are also common Euphoria is also sometimes seen. Increased ventilation or hyperventilation is occurs as a compensatory mechanism in Chronic oxygen deficiency to maintain the oxygen saturation and normal bodily …

WebDec 31, 2024 · Iron deficiency anemia reduces the capacity to get oxygen to the tissues of the body. Common symptoms include shortness of breath, fatigue, pale skin, headaches, heart palpitations, and cold hands and feet.
